FAQS on black slate stone tile

Q: How do I maintain black slate stone tiles?

A: Clean black slate stone tiles regularly with a pH-neutral cleaner and warm water. Avoid abrasive tools to prevent scratches. Seal the tiles annually to preserve their natural finish and durability.

Q: Are black slate peel and stick tiles easy to install?

A: Yes, black slate peel and stick tiles are designed for simple DIY installation. Ensure the surface is clean, dry, and smooth before applying. No grout or adhesives are required, making them a time-saving option.

Q: Where can I use black slate look tiles in my home?

A: Black slate look tiles work well in kitchens, bathrooms, and fireplaces. They mimic natural slate but are lighter and more affordable. Avoid high-moisture areas unless they’re specifically rated for waterproof use.

Q: What’s the difference between black slate stone tiles and peel-and-stick versions?

A: Black slate stone tiles are natural stone, offering authentic texture but requiring sealing. Peel-and-stick versions are vinyl or PVC-based, providing a similar aesthetic with easier installation. The latter is ideal for temporary or low-budget projects.

Q: Can black slate peel and stick tiles withstand heavy foot traffic?

A: High-quality black slate peel and stick tiles are durable for moderate foot traffic. Avoid using them in high-traffic commercial spaces. Check the product’s durability rating before purchasing for long-term use.
